Dr. Bieniasz is one of the leading virologists in the United States. His did his Ph.D. work with Myra McClure at St. Mary’s in London studying foamy virus replication and post-doctoral work with Bryan Cullen at Duke studying HIV entry and the molecular regulation of HIV transcription. In 1999 he started his lab at the Aaron Diamond AIDS Research Center (affiliated with Rockefeller University) in New York City where he worked for 20 years prior to transitioning to Rockefeller proper in 2019. He has been an HHMI investigator since 2008. Over his career, Dr. Bieniasz’s lab has made myriad major contributions to our understanding of HIV replication, the host antiviral immune response, HIV animal models, and evolution of retroviruses including the discovery of TSG101 as a HIV-1 host factor, the first real-time visualization of HIV-1 budding and genome packaging, the discovery of the host antiviral restriction factor Tetherin, the identification of Mx2 as a host restriction factor blocking HIV entry, and elucidation of the mechanism by which HIV circumvents Zinc Finger Antiviral Protein, and antiviral factor that restricts RNA virus gene expression.
